- A self-contained flat is a unit of accommodation that has access to all three basic amenities (personal washing, WC and cooking facilities) for the exclusive use of the occupier12. The occupier does not have to share these amenities with anyone else or pass through the common parts of the accommodation1. A self-contained flat can cover more than one floor and have its own staircase and entrance, such as a maisonette23.Learn more:✕This summary was generated using AI based on multiple online sources.
